> On Sat Aug 30 2014 Eric Abrahamsen wrote:
>> I've never even gotten bbdb-print to work, it's always complained
>> about undefined control sequences or something.
>
> The lisp code should work fine. I made sure that bbdb-print-record
> does not fail in the rare case that the value of an xfield is a
> sexp. Also, bbdb-print now issues a message at the end that the
> resulting file should be processed with tex, but not with latex
> (till someone writes a LaTeX template).

>> The tex code is very old, and doesn't make any provisions for
>> non-latin characters. Probably the easiest stop-gap would be to
>> change bbdb-print-prolog and bbdb-print-epilog to wrap the whole
>> thing in latex statements or what have you, either make use of
>> babel, or xelatex. I don't know if that would be enough to do the
>> trick, but if it worked it would be the simplest solution.
>
> The current plain TeX templates work well for me with latin utf8
> characters, but they fail with, say, japanese characters (which
> happen to be the only non-latin characters in my BBDB).

For you information: The documentation in bbdb-print.el is also partly
outdated.
;;; In the *BBDB* buffer, type P to convert the listing to TeX
;;; format. It will prompt you for a filename. Then run TeX on that
;;; file and print it out.
Now we have:
P runs the command bbdb-prev-field, which is an interactive compiled
Lisp function in `bbdb.el'.
